Skip to content

Commit 21b894f

Browse files
committed
refactor(services/gcs): migrate to reqsign v2
1 parent d37828e commit 21b894f

File tree

7 files changed

+322
-189
lines changed

7 files changed

+322
-189
lines changed

core/Cargo.lock

Lines changed: 25 additions & 30 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

core/services/gcs/Cargo.toml

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-31,17 +31,17 @@ version = { workspace = true }
3131
all-features = true
3232

3333
[dependencies]
34-
backon = "1.6"
34+
async-trait = "0.1"
3535
bytes = { workspace = true }
3636
http = { workspace = true }
3737
log = { workspace = true }
3838
opendal-core = { path = "../../core", version = "0.55.0", default-features = false }
3939
percent-encoding = "2.3"
4040
quick-xml = { workspace = true, features = ["serialize"] }
41-
reqsign = { workspace = true, features = [
42-
"reqwest_request",
43-
"services-google",
44-
] }
41+
reqsign-core = { version = "2.0.1", default-features = false }
42+
reqsign-file-read-tokio = { version = "2.0.1", default-features = false }
43+
reqsign-google = { version = "2.0.2", default-features = false }
44+
reqsign-http-send-reqwest = { version = "2.0.1", default-features = false }
4545
reqwest = { version = "0.12.24", default-features = false, features = [
4646
"json",
4747
"stream",

0 commit comments

Comments
 (0)